#02c668 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#02c668 is composed of 0.8% red, 77.6%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 99% cyan, 0% magenta, 47.5% yellow and 22.4% black. It has a hue angle of 151.2 degrees, a saturation of 98% and a lightness of 39.2%. #02c668 color hex could be obtained by blending #04ffd0 with #008d00. Closest websafe color is: #00cc66.

Shades and Tints of #02c668
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000402 is the darkest color, while #effff7 is the lightest one.
